Measurement of radon exhalation rate from soil samples of Garhwal Himalaya, India

Description
Laboratory experiment was performed for the measurement of radon exhalation rate from the soil samples collected from Garhwal Himalayas. This study is accompanied by the measurement of soil-gas radon concentration in the same area. Both results were compared with the geological formation and structure of the area. No correlation was observed between soil-gas radon concentration and radon exhalation rate. However, it was found to be controlled by the lithology, geological structure and uranium mineralization in the area. The relationship between radon emanation, geological formation and occurrence of high indoor radon concentration is discussed. (author)
